**CyprusBusiness.com Launches Comprehensive Digital Platform for Business and Investment Information**

*Nicosia, Cyprus* – In a significant development for entrepreneurs and investors, CyprusBusiness.com has officially launched a new digital platform aimed at providing essential information and resources related to business, residency, real estate, and investment opportunities in Cyprus. This initiative is expected to streamline access to vital information for both local and international stakeholders looking to navigate the Cypriot market.

The new platform is designed to cater to a diverse audience, including business owners, potential investors, expatriates, and anyone interested in relocating to Cyprus. It offers a wealth of resources that cover various aspects of doing business in the country, from legal requirements and tax regulations to market trends and sector-specific insights.

One of the key features of the platform is its comprehensive guide on residency options available in Cyprus. This includes detailed information on the various visa categories, residency permits, and the criteria that applicants must meet. The platform aims to demystify the often complex immigration processes, making it easier for individuals and families to understand their options for living and working in Cyprus.

In addition to residency information, CyprusBusiness.com provides an extensive overview of the real estate market. Users can find listings of properties for sale or rent, along with insights into market conditions, pricing trends, and investment potential in various regions of the island. This feature is particularly beneficial for foreign investors looking to enter the Cypriot real estate market, as it offers a centralized resource for property-related information.

The investment section of the platform highlights various opportunities across different sectors, including tourism, technology, and agriculture. It outlines the advantages of investing in Cyprus, such as the strategic geographic location, favorable tax regime, and the skilled workforce. The platform also features success stories and case studies of businesses that have thrived in the Cypriot economy, providing inspiration and practical examples for prospective investors.

CyprusBusiness.com aims to be a one-stop shop for anyone interested in the Cypriot business landscape. By consolidating crucial information into a single digital space, the platform seeks to enhance the ease of access for users and promote Cyprus as an attractive destination for business and investment.

The launch of this platform comes at a time when Cyprus is actively seeking to attract foreign investment and stimulate economic growth. The government has implemented various initiatives to create a more business-friendly environment, and platforms like CyprusBusiness.com align with these efforts by providing essential tools and resources for stakeholders.
